What is a Pomsky?

Pomskies are a mix between Pomeranians and Siberian Huskies. They are a relatively new hybrid breed that has gained popularity over the years due to their small size, cute looks, and friendly personality. Pomskies come in different sizes ranging from toy to standard with an average weight of 20-30 pounds and height of 10-15 inches at the shoulder.

Pomskies have thick coats that can be black, white, gray, red, or brown. Some Pomskies may have markings like masks, spots, or stripes inherited from their husky parentage. They have erect ears and a fluffy tail that curls over their back. Pomskies are known for their playful and affectionate nature. They are good with children and other pets and make excellent companions for families.

Factors Affecting Pomsky Prices

Before we delve into the cost of Pomskies in detail, it’s essential to understand the factors that affect their prices. Here are some of the main things that influence Pomsky prices:

  • Breeder Reputation: Reputable breeders who produce high-quality Pomskies with health guarantees and proper socialization tend to charge more than backyard breeders or puppy mills that prioritize profits over the welfare of their dogs.
  • Pomsky Size: The size of Pomsky you want can impact its cost. Smaller Pomskies, such as toy or teacup sizes, may command a higher price than standard-sized ones because they are rarer and require more care during breeding and whelping.
  • Pomsky Coat Color and Type: Pomskies with unique coat colors or patterns may be more expensive than those with more common colors. Additionally, Pomskies with thicker, fluffier coats may require more grooming and maintenance, which can increase their overall cost.
  • Location: The price of Pomskies varies depending on your geographic location. In general, Pomskies in urban areas tend to be more expensive than those in rural areas due to higher living costs and demand.

Average Cost of Pomskies in the USA

The average cost of a Pomsky in the USA ranges from $1,500 to $5,000. However, some breeders may charge as much as $10,000 for rare or highly sought-after Pomskies. You should also factor in additional expenses such as shipping fees if you’re buying a Pomsky from another state or country.

If you’re looking for a cheaper option, you may find Pomskies for sale on classified websites like Craigslist or Facebook Marketplace. However, beware of scams or unscrupulous breeders who may sell sick, poorly bred, or mistreated dogs at low prices. Always do your research and only buy from reputable breeders who have a track record of producing healthy and well-socialized Pomskies.

Where to Buy a Pomsky?

If you’ve decided that a Pomsky is the right dog for you, the next step is to find a reputable breeder who can provide you with a healthy and happy puppy. Here are some places where you can look for Pomskies for sale:

  • Breeders: Look for Pomsky breeders in your local area or online. Check their website or social media pages to see if they have any available puppies or upcoming litters. Contact them to ask about their breeding practices, health testing, and guarantees.
  • Pet Stores: Some pet stores may sell Pomskies, but it’s best to avoid them as they often source their dogs from puppy mills or unethical breeders. Pet stores may also charge higher prices than breeders.
  • Rescue Organizations: Consider adopting a Pomsky from a rescue organization or shelter. They may have adult Pomskies or puppies available for adoption at lower prices than buying from a breeder. Adopting also helps reduce animal overpopulation and gives a deserving dog a second chance at life.
